Output 3eaaf3194f9fc6e7a072bcde9b67ca9c7641d0965b2092682d75ecd0a1316004:0

value
1070687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96fc3be572088b17a942ddfc7a9b7128e1ad088b OP_EQUAL
address
MMfVkjByR21AGKdjyB3HVa5mssVTpGEgi7
transaction
3eaaf3194f9fc6e7a072bcde9b67ca9c7641d0965b2092682d75ecd0a1316004
spent
true